What are two outer planets that are about the same size?

Uranus and Neptune are two outer planets that are similar in size. Both planets are known as ice giants and are similar in diameter and mass.

Why aren't all the planets same colour?

Planets have different colors because of variations in their composition and atmosphere. Factors like the presence of different minerals, gases, and atmospheric conditions can affect the color of a planet. Additionally, the angle at which sunlight hits the planet can also influence its appearance.
